What does a merchandising associate do?

Merchandise associates ensure that customers get a complete shopping experience. They pleasantly arrange and stock merchandise on shelves for customers to purchase. Also, they assemble product displays and make sure popular and on-sale products are visible to customers. Part of their duty is to place the appropriate sales tag on items and record new developments in the store's inventory. Skills required for the job include excellent customer service, being detail-oriented, and relevant experience in sales.

What does a seasonal associate do?

Seasonal Associates are employees in a retail store during a particular season, such as holidays or school breaks. They may also be employed in any other business with a high volume of customers or clients, like theme parks, restaurants, or holiday destinations, during the aforementioned seasons. As such, they usually work on administrative or clerical activities. They may help in overseeing the store display, assisting customers, taking inventory, and restocking shelves, among others. In case seasonal associates do exceptionally well, the company may offer them a full-time engagement.
